Prince Ogunwusi’s mother, Margaret Wuraola Sidikatu Abegbe Ogunwusi,
was born into the family of Soji-Opa, a prominent Cocoa merchant in
Ile-Ife.
He attended The Polytechnic, Ibadan, where he obtained a Higher National Diploma (HND) in Accountancy.
He grew rapidly in business, after school, becoming a successful real estate merchant.
His
bio on the website of Imperial Homes Mortgage Bank Limited (a
subsidiary of GTBank) on which board he sits as non executive director,
reads, “Mr. Ogunwusi is a graduate of Accountancy and a certified member
of the Institute of Chartered Accountants of Nigeria and of the
Institute of Management.
He has been involved in engineering, procurement and construction (EPC) contracts locally and abroad for over 11 years.
He
was involved in the development of the Northern Foreshore Estate,
Cityscape International Limited’s Buena Vista project in Lekki,
Primewaterview Limited’s projects, Westcom Limited’s projects, and the
Ajaokuta Steel’s and Delta Steel’s resuscitation projects
He is
currently the Managing Director of Howard Roark Gardens Limited which is
undertaking multi-million naira Jacob Mews Estate project in Yaba and
the Lakeview real estate development in Lekki.
To become Ooni, Mr.
Ogunwusi defeated 20 other contenders, including his 48-year old real
estate- magnate brother, Adetunji, the Group Chairman of Primewaterview
Holdings (comprising of Primewaterview Limited and PWV Management
Services).
